powered by simpleCommunicator - 2.0.60     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Caché, Ensemble, DeepSee, MiniM, IRIS, GT.M [игнор отключен] [закрыт для гостей] / Не могу открыть объект.. что не так?
3 сообщений из 3, страница 1 из 1
Не могу открыть объект.. что не так?
    #36438384
CacheLot
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Пытаюсь сделать универсальный метод для открытия объекта по названию класса и его ID с дальнейшей передачей объектной ссылки в другой метод...
Делаю так:
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
//Метод, возвращающий ссылку на существующий объект, при заданных
//Имени класса, и Id%
Method GetMyObject(GMOClassName,GMOId) [ZenMethod]
{
	s MyObject="##class("_GMOClassName_").%OpenId("_GMOId_")"
	s MyReturn=@MyObject
	q MyReturn
}

При этом SYNTAX ощшибка...

ДО этого сделал метод удаления, который без проблем заработал:
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
//Метод удаления объекта 

Method DeleteObject(DOId, DOClassName) [ ZenMethod ]
{
	s x="##class("_DOClassName_").%DeleteId("_DOId_")"
	d @x
	q
}


В чём может быть ошибка уже 100 раз проверил, что-то с косвенностью не так??
...
Рейтинг: 0 / 0
Не могу открыть объект.. что не так?
    #36438394
Фотография DAiMor
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
все уже придумано, нет нужды изобретать велосипедов
во первых не забываем про функции $zobjXXXX
во вторых есть $system.OBJ.OpenId(cls,id)

_________________________________
Cache for Windows NT (AMD64) 5.0.21 (Build 6408) Tue Jan 3 2006 13:37:41 EST
...
Рейтинг: 0 / 0
Не могу открыть объект.. что не так?
    #36438429
CacheLot
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
DAiMorвсе уже придумано, нет нужды изобретать велосипедов
во первых не забываем про функции $zobjXXXX
во вторых есть $system.OBJ.OpenId(cls,id)

благодарю!
...
Рейтинг: 0 / 0
3 сообщений из 3, страница 1 из 1
Форумы / Caché, Ensemble, DeepSee, MiniM, IRIS, GT.M [игнор отключен] [закрыт для гостей] / Не могу открыть объект.. что не так?
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]